Mathoid is a nodjs service which takes various forms of math input and converts it to MathML + SVG or PNG output.

Important!Beginning with BlueSpice 4.x, Mathoid is no longer distributed and has to installed separately.

If mathematical formulas are not rendered in your wiki, please check that extensions/Math/webservices/mathoid.tar.gz is deployed in the correct folder:

  • Linux: /opt/mathoid
  • Windows: C:\BlueSpice\bin\mathoid


PDF-Export integrationThe PDF-Export does not support SVGs at the moment. Therefore the SVG needs to be converted into a PNG when embedded into a PDF. This is done automatically, but requires $wgSVGConverter to be set up properly. It is recommended to use rsvg as a converter. On Debian based linux environments it can be installed with
apt install librsvg2-bin

In the LocalSettings.php file it must be configured with

$GLOBALS['wgSVGConverter'] = 'rsvg';
